Case Study: Foam Detection In Fermentation Process

During the fermentation process in Breweries, Wine making or Alcohol production there is a risk that the fermentation gets out of control, this can result in foam overflowing or getting into the CO2 vent.

By installing a tuningfork point level switch (Liquiphant) tuned for foam detection at the top of the fermenter, the foam is detected before it reaches critical point and control steps are taken to suppress foam and get fermentation back under control. User selected the tuning fork but a capacitance sensor based system would have worked also. Selection is purely by user preference.

Since installing the tuning forks there has been no further incident requiring clean-up. The plant had on average 1-2 incidents per year prior to installation, at a cost of minimum 1 day downtime and associated clean-up cost. The $700.00 switch paid for itself right away.
